Way forward for straw burning pollution research: a bibliometric analysis during 1972-2016.

Meihe Jiang1, Yaoqiang Huo1, Kai Huang2

  • 1College of Environmental Science and Engineering, Beijing Forestry University, Beijing, 100083, People's Republic of China.

Environmental Science and Pollution Research International
|March 20, 2019
PubMed
Summary

Research on straw burning pollution has significantly increased, with most studies in English. Future research should focus on emission mechanisms, inventories, and health impacts.

Area of Science:

  • Environmental Sciences and Ecology
  • Agriculture
  • Meteorology and Atmospheric Sciences

Background:

  • Straw burning poses significant risks to public health and contributes to haze events.
  • Understanding straw burning pollution is crucial for environmental management.

Purpose of the Study:

  • To conduct a bibliometric analysis of straw burning research from 1972 to 2016.
  • To identify research progress, trends, and future directions in straw burning pollution studies.

Main Methods:

  • Bibliometric analysis of publications from the Science Citation Index Expanded (Web of Science).
  • Analysis of document type, language, publication year, citations, subject categories, journals, national and institutional contributions, and author data.

Main Results:

  • A significant increase in straw burning pollution research over 45 years, with 813 publications found.
  • English is the dominant language; articles are the most common document type.
  • Key research areas include environmental sciences, agriculture, and atmospheric sciences.
  • Major journals are 'Atmospheric Environment' and 'Atmospheric Chemistry and Physics'.
  • China leads in publication quantity, followed by the USA and India.
  • Chinese Academy of Sciences is the most productive institution.

Conclusions:

  • Future research should prioritize emission characteristic mechanisms, high-resolution emission inventory construction, and the impact of straw burning pollutants on climate and human health.
  • The study provides a reference for future research directions in straw burning pollution.
